MU students take lead in national road safety campaign

Three postgraduate students from Maynooth University (MU) have won the overall prize in an Garda Síochána’s Road Safety Reimagined campaign, highlighting the dangers of drug driving.

New orchestra project

Announcing Just Play!, a partnership between MU and Music Generation Offaly-Westmeath to form a regional orchestra combining second and third-level students with professional musicians
